Concrete edging services involve installing a durable border around lawns, flower beds, pathways, or other landscaped areas. This process typically includes preparing the ground, shaping the concrete, and finishing it to create a clean, defined edge that enhances the overall appearance of outdoor spaces. The goal is to create a low-maintenance boundary that helps keep soil, mulch, and grass contained, reducing the need for frequent trimming or re-edging. Many homeowners choose concrete edging because it offers a long-lasting, tidy solution that complements various landscaping styles.
One common problem that concrete edging helps solve is the issue of overgrown grass or spreading mulch that can encroach on walkways or garden beds. Without a proper barrier, weeds and grass can quickly invade landscaped areas, making outdoor spaces look unkempt. Concrete borders also prevent soil erosion and help maintain the shape of flower beds and lawn areas over time. This service can be especially useful for properties that experience heavy foot traffic or have uneven terrain, where a sturdy edge can provide both functional and aesthetic benefits.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Edging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Delaware,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ete edging repairs in Delaware, OH range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of the spectrum.
Standard Installation - Installing new concrete edging for a standard-sized yard us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Most homeowners find their projects land within this range, with larger or more complex designs potentially costing more.
Custom Designs - Custom or decorative concrete edging can range from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. While many projects stay within this higher tier, highly intricate or large-scale installations can push costs further depending on detail and scope.
Full Replacement - Replacing existing concrete edging entirely typically costs between $3,000 and $7,000. Larger, more involved projects with extensive removal and new installation tend to fall into this range, though costs vary with project size and compl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
